Struct aws_sdk_sagemaker::input::CreateDeviceFleetInput
source · [−]#[non_exhaustive]pub struct CreateDeviceFleetInput {
pub device_fleet_name: Option<String>,
pub role_arn: Option<String>,
pub description: Option<String>,
pub output_config: Option<EdgeOutputConfig>,
pub tags: Option<Vec<Tag>>,
pub enable_iot_role_alias: Option<bool>,
}

The name of the fleet that the device belongs to.
role_arn: Option<String>
The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) that has access to Amazon Web Services Internet of Things (IoT).
description: Option<String>
A description of the fleet.
output_config: Option<EdgeOutputConfig>
The output configuration for storing sample data collected by the fleet.
Creates tags for the specified fleet.
enable_iot_role_alias: Option<bool>
Whether to create an Amazon Web Services IoT Role Alias during device fleet creation. The name of the role alias generated will match this pattern: "SageMakerEdge-{DeviceFleetName}".
For example, if your device fleet is called "demo-fleet", the name of the role alias will be "SageMakerEdge-demo-fleet".
